推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
搭建一个智能问答系统是实现高效信息检索的关键步骤。本文提供了一条从零开始至 Claude 问答系统的全面指南,涵盖基础概念、关键技术、数据处理与模型训练等内容,旨在帮助开发者快速构建和优化智能问答系统。
在人工智能技术蓬勃发展的今天,问答系统已经广泛应用于日常生活中的各个领域,无论是搜索引擎、智能客服还是在线教育,问答系统都在发挥着重要作用,近年来,大型语言模型Claude凭借其卓越的对话能力和丰富的知识库,成为构建高效问答系统的重要选择,本文将深入探讨如何基于Claude搭建一个功能完善、性能优越的问答系统。
1. 前景与挑战
随着互联网信息量的增长,用户对即时、精准的信息需求日益增长,传统的问答系统往往面临数据量不足、知识更新不及时等问题,而Claude作为一款基于大型语言模型的语言处理工具,能够提供丰富、准确的知识资源,并且支持实时学习和更新,这无疑为问答系统的改进提供了新的可能。
2. 技术栈选择
搭建问答系统需要选择合适的开发技术和平台,对于Claude问答系统而言,Python是一个不可多得的选择,因为Python具有简洁易懂的语法和强大的第三方库支持,除此之外,还需要使用一些自然语言处理(NLP)库如NLTK、spaCy等来处理文本数据,提取关键信息,进行实体识别和情感分析,为了提高系统性能和用户体验,还可以考虑引入微服务架构、缓存机制以及数据库优化等技术手段。
3. 数据准备与预处理
构建高质量的回答系统离不开海量、高质量的数据支撑,需要收集相关领域的知识资料,例如百科全书、专业书籍、新闻报道等,然后利用自然语言处理工具对这些文本进行清洗、分词、去停用词等预处理操作,进一步抽取有价值的知识点,建立语料库,还需要对原始数据进行标注,以便于后续训练模型时进行监督学习。
4. 模型训练与调优
利用大规模语料库训练Claude模型是一项复杂但至关重要的步骤,首先通过机器学习算法如神经网络、深度学习等方法构建模型框架,并利用大规模数据集进行训练,在此过程中,可以通过调整超参数、优化算法等方式不断优化模型性能,训练完成后,还需通过交叉验证等方法评估模型的效果,并根据实际情况进行调整以获得最佳表现。
5. 系统设计与部署
完成模型训练后,接下来便是系统的设计与部署工作,需要根据应用场景需求制定详细的系统架构设计方案,包括前端界面设计、后端服务器配置、数据库选择等,为了确保系统的稳定性和可扩展性,可以采用微服务架构,实现模块化开发和独立部署,还需考虑安全性问题,在系统中加入数据加密、身份验证等措施,保护用户隐私和系统安全。
6. 后期维护与迭代
问答系统上线后,还需要持续关注用户反馈及使用情况,定期更新模型和知识库,保证其始终处于最佳状态,还可以利用自然语言生成技术自动生成个性化推荐,增强用户体验,通过数据分析挖掘潜在价值,不断优化系统功能和服务质量。
相关关键词
问答系统, Claude问答系统, 大规模语言模型, Python编程, NLP技术, 微服务架构, 数据预处理, 模型训练, 系统设计, 后期维护, 安全性防护, 自然语言生成
本文标签属性:
Claude问答系统搭建:问答系统有哪些
AI:ai小程序开发